Output 59664bbdc2d0bd0fcd3fddf6d4644ea5f7128cbc57f1c5dd40b4edf3e402d9e4:1

value
34710945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cd85e5ae1271d3235c0080960af201bae86703d OP_EQUAL
address
3QjwQSJhP1i63LnwF1GGd7PWCEJoaBvz29
transaction
59664bbdc2d0bd0fcd3fddf6d4644ea5f7128cbc57f1c5dd40b4edf3e402d9e4
confirmations
374962
spent
true